Abstract

The present disclosure provides an electric propulsor. The electric propulsor has a propeller having a hub and blades extending from the hub. The blades are movable along respective flapping axes between a deployed position and a stowed position. The electric propulsor also has an actuator and an electric motor coupled with the hub and arranged to rotatably drive the propeller. Further, the electric propulsor has one or more processors configured to: receive an input indicating an azimuthal position of the blades; control the electric motor to align the blades with a target azimuthal position based at least in part on the input; and with the blades of the propeller arranged at the target azimuthal position, cause the actuator to translate a control rod coupled thereto and with the hub to actively fold or unfold the blades along the respective flapping axes of the blades.
